Social-media impersonation scam-spike. Applicable: @solendprotocol on X is the official account. The rebrand to 'Save' (a highly generic English word, per U22) significantly complicates brand-protection monitoring — automated detection of 'save' scam accounts requires disambiguation. No public reports of a major Solend/Save impersonation spike as of 2026-05-17. Social-media monitor has not been built.
